What is the Aeroscope?
The Aeroscope is essentially a sophisticated drone detection system that provides real-time information about the presence and behavior of drones in a specified area. Think of it as a radar system, but for the buzzing little machines that seem to be everywhere these days. It can identify the make, model, and even the location of the drone operator, making it an invaluable tool for law enforcement and security agencies.
How Does It Work?
So, how does this nifty gadget actually operate? The Aeroscope uses a combination of signal processing and advanced algorithms to detect drone communications. It listens for signals transmitted between the drone and its operator, decoding the data to provide a comprehensive overview of the drone's activity. Applications Across Industries
The benefits of the Aeroscope extend far beyond just identifying rogue drones. Various sectors can harness this technology to improve operations:
- Security: Airports, stadiums, and other high-security venues can use the Aeroscope to monitor airspace, preventing unauthorized drone flights.
- Law Enforcement: Police can employ this system during events or protests, ensuring public safety by monitoring aerial activities.
- Event Management: Concerts and festivals can leverage this tech to maintain a secure environment for attendees.
